Bordo las Barrancas
Bordo las Barrancas is an intermittent reservoir in Coahuila, Northern Mexico and has an elevation of 1,237 metres. Bordo las Barrancas is situated nearby to the village Trincheras, as well as near the locality El Área.- Type: Intermittent reservoir
